Ways to Boost your skincare routine: 

Add face masks: Ever since serums got more limelight, people gradually started forgetting about face masks. Face sheets were introduced and continued to get all the attention, but you should also consider applying clay masks, magnetic masks, peel-off masks, etc every once in a while. You can also try your hands on DIY masks. Get creative with the items from your kitchen and garden: add aloe vera, turmeric, fruits, milk, rose petals, etc.

 

Facial massage: Facial massage boosts oxygen flow and blood circulation in the skin and increases collagen production while working the facial muscles. Believe it or not, you can actually add a few minutes extra in your skincare routine for facial massage. Whenever you apply serum, moisturizer, or facial oil, use upwards and outwards movements with your knuckles to depuff your skin. There are several YouTube tutorials available to learn about facial massage. You can also incorporate beauty tools like jade rollers. 

 

Plant-based diet: Your skin will not only respond to the topical products you apply but also to what you eat. Including fruits, veggies, and eliminating processed, sugary, fatty, oily, and fast food from your diet will maintain your skin's health from within and will promote a natural glow on the outside. 

 

Facial tools: You need not make trips to your dermatologists in order to have a clear and lifted complexion. There are several facial tools worth trying - from derma rollers to gua sha, jade rollers, and microcurrent massagers, the options are plenty.

Understanding skincare ingredients: It is a possibility that most skincare products are formulated with the same active ingredients. Label check the products before buying to make sure you're not loading up on the same ingredients in different products.

 

You can simplify your routine by understanding which ingredients to use in which form. For example, Vitamin C works best when used in the form of a potent serum than a cleanser. Whereas, salicylic acid works best when used in the form of an exfoliant than a cleanser. 

 

Also, keep a close eye on the ingredients that aggravate your skin concerns. Always do a patch test on your hand before applying the product directly to your face, this will help you differentiate the ingredients that your skin is sensitive to.

Commit to your products/routine: Buying and stocking up skincare products, filling your cosmetics cabinet, and not actually using them consistently can prove to be a major setback from the goal of healthy and glowing skin. Must commit to the product(s) you have bought and follow your routine consistently to witness a visible result. 

 

Minimal skincare: 2022 is the year of skinminimalism! Rather than having a 10+ steps skincare routine, look for multi-tasking products that will reduce the need for an elaborate routine. Categorize the products: Categorize your products so as not to feel too overwhelmed whenever you open your cosmetics shelf and find a pool of products. Organize the products based on the frequency of usage to boost your skincare routine into a more organized one. 

  • Daily essentials: Cleansers, toners, serums, moisturizers, and sunscreen are your daily skincare essentials. Invest majorly in these and keep these on the top shelf to mark them as important or a priority. 
  • Weekly casuals: Exfoliants, face masks, sheet masks facial oils, eye creams, etc, are used once or twice a week. These can go on the middle shelf, to mark their importance as 'weekly use'. 

Add ons: Beauty tools are the add ons that are used every once in a while. You can keep these tools on the bottom shelf.
